[ Summary ] |
Recently, EUS-guided biliary drainage for obstructive jaundice has been developed as an alternative to endoscopic transpapillary or percutaneous biliary drainage. Although several reports have showen it to be an effective and safe treatment for obstructive jaundice, they were done retrospectively with small sample sizes. Therefore, EUS-guided biliary drainage should be reserved for endoscopists at tertiary care centers with advanced training in EUS. |
